Output 51c30a126cd106a6f3f866166a5d239b01c23d0a95b9d8c35b789c3834531895:1

value
2826398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0da826418182edd7b77a2a4e136f58d68b1c3ac0 OP_EQUAL
address
32wE9GLaD1H39CizhABkkF45ayjFT2Zv9T
transaction
51c30a126cd106a6f3f866166a5d239b01c23d0a95b9d8c35b789c3834531895
spent
true